Guest Name and Bio: Dr. Peter Kozlowski

As a Functional Medicine M.D., Dr. Peter Kozlowski uses a broad array of tools to find the source of the body's dysfunction: he takes the time to listen to his patients and plots their history on a timeline, considering what makes them unique and co-creating with them a truly individualized care plan. Currently he works with patients online and in person via his Chicago, Illinois and Bozeman, Montana based offices. Dr. Kozlowski did his residency in Family Practice, but started training in Functional Medicine as an intern. He trained in the clinics with leaders in his field including Dr. Mark Hyman, Dr. Deepak Chopra, and Dr. Susan Blum. His recently published book Unfunc Your Gut encapsulates his collaborative, patient-first healthcare approach—in true research-based, conversational style, it offers a blend of medical insight and the experiential wisdom of his own healing journey through addiction recovery. Overall Doc Koz inspires us off the Internet to seek and find real answers to "what's going on with my health?" and empowers readers with practical strategies (and delicious recipes) to achieve true balance of body, mind and spirit. His expertise is in gut health, but he also works daily with food sensitivities, hormone imbalances, detoxing from toxic chemicals such as heavy metals and mold, and most importantly mental, emotional, and spiritual health.

What you will learn from this episode: 1) Why is the gut microbiome important 2) What is leaky gut 3) How to start planning an elimination diet 4) The role of stress in gut health 5) How to manage small intestinal bacterial overgrowth (SIBO)

Guest Name and Bio: Dr. Anurag Singh

Anurag Singh is currently Chief Medical Officer at Amazentis SA, a clinical stage biotech company based in Lausanne, Switzerland that discovers and develops next generation natural compounds targeting improvements in mitochondrial health. In particular, Dr. Singh has led the clinical development program for the natural mitophagy activator, Urolithin A that led to the commercial launch of several branded consumer health products targeting improvements in cellular health. Dr. Singh received his medical training (MBBS) in Internal Medicine from the Armed Forces Medical College, Pune, India and a PhD in Immunology from the University of Connecticut in Farmington, Connecticut, USA. He also holds an executive MBA from EcolePolytechnique Federal de Lausanne (EPFL) in Switzerland. He has authored >30 articles in top peer-reviewed journals, holds >10 patents and has designed and led >40 clinical trials over the last 15 yrs.

What you will learn from this episode: 1) Why the mitochondria are important to our health 2) What is the best diet for the mitochondria 3) How does the gut microbiome influence the mitochondria 4) What is Urolithin A and how can it influence health 5) What is the safety and benefit profile of UrolithinA
